Mare Street is in London and in Hackney district. E8 4RG is located in the London Fields elect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Hackney South and Shoreditch.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ding E8 4RG has a slightly higher male population, with 51.7%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Female | 50.9% | 48.3% | -2.6% | 51.0% | -2.7% |
| Male | 49.1% | 51.7% | 2.6% | 49.0% | 2.7% |
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ate area around E8 4RG,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 77.9%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Single | 66.3% | 77.9% | 11.6% | 37.9% | 40.0% |
| Married: Opposite sex | 21.5% | 16.5% | -5.0% | 44.2% | -27.7% |
| Married: Same sex | 2.7% | 0% | -2.7% | 0.3% | -0.3% |
| Separated | 3.8% | 3.1% | -0.7% | 2.2% | 0.9% |
| Divorced | 5.4% | 2.2% | -3.2% | 9.1% | -6.9% |
| Widowed | 0.4% | 0.3% | -0.1% | 6.1% | -5.8% |
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.
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.
This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(88.7%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Very good health | 59.1% | 55.1% | -4.0% | 48.4% | 6.7% |
| Good health | 27.5% | 33.6% | 6.1% | 33.6% | 0.0% |
| Fair health | 8.5% | 7.9% | -0.6% | 12.7% | -4.8% |
| Bad health | 3.5% | 2.9% | -0.6% | 4.0% | -1.1% |
| Very bad health | 1.5% | 0.5% | -1.0% | 1.2% | -0.7%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Mare Street was 73.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 40.9% lower than the Haggerston average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.
Mare Street has the 15th lowest crime rate of 52 local areas in Haggerston and the 143rd lowest crime rate of 580 local areas in Hackney .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 19.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-45.9%.
